Chapter 100: Luoyao Market District
Therefore, in the following days, Chu Xin’er did not rush to search for the remaining three types of spiritual herbs. She first found a suitable secluded place to establish a cave dwelling, then began to master the flying needle technique and its control.
Taking advantage of this time, Xiao Wenzi did not continue exchanging pills to break through his bottleneck. Instead, he calmly absorbed the spiritual energy of heaven and earth to stabilize his realm.
The valley Chu Xin’er chose was extremely remote, and with the formation array shielding the cave entrance, more than half a month passed without any reckless cultivators coming to provoke them.
Old Xu’s cultivation level was about the same as Chu Xin’er’s, so the techniques he practiced were naturally not difficult for her to understand—especially since she was only focusing on comprehending the manipulation and use of flying needles.
After this period of time, Chu Xin’er was already able to skillfully control the flying needle artifact, capable of striking an enemy silently and unexpectedly.
At the same time, Xiao Wenzi’s late ninth-tier Heavenly Realm had stabilized. It was time to leave. After a simple packing, Chu Xin’er quietly departed from this temporary cave dwelling.
The path of immortality is long; the Qi Refining stage is merely the beginning. Only upon truly entering the Foundation Establishment stage can one be said to have some ability to protect oneself, and lifespan would multiply greatly from the original base.
However, Foundation Establishment pills are expensive, and ordinary cultivators cannot rely solely on their own cultivation to break through bottlenecks. Thus, acquiring spiritual herbs and flowers becomes especially important.
In the following days, Chu Xin’er continued to roam in mountain valleys far from towns.
Yet the results left her somewhat disheartened. Although she found some spiritual flowers and herbs during these days, none of them were the three materials she lacked for refining the Foundation Establishment pill.
This was quite normal; a single batch of the pill requires dozens of rare materials and treasures from heaven and earth.
Old Xu had searched for a long time and had barely gathered over half of them. Within just a few months, Chu Xin’er had already obtained over ninety percent. If other Qi Refining cultivators knew of this, they would surely be envious and resentful.
“Hmm, continuing like this isn’t a solution. I need to change my strategy...” she mused.
A few more days passed with no progress, and Chu Xin’er decided to visit the marketplace.
First, she only needed three kinds of spiritual herbs: Purple Violet Vine, Jasmine Cloud Grass, and Antelope Blood Ginseng. These should not be difficult to find in a larger market. Second, after several battles, her wealth was somewhat more abundant than that of a typical Qi Refining cultivator.
By selling off unused storage bags, artifacts, and spare herbs and pills, along with her accumulated spirit stones, she had more than enough to purchase the three herbs.
The only difficulty, or rather concern, was that Chu Xin’er feared attracting the covetous attention of those with ill intent. After all, any cultivator with even a basic understanding of pharmacology could easily guess she was preparing to refine a Foundation Establishment pill.
As the saying goes, wealth invites trouble. Foundation Establishment pills are very valuable.
A complete set of materials for refining such a pill is not only alluring to low-level cultivators, but even those who have broken through to the Foundation Establishment stage would be tempted.
Because it is hard to guarantee that the other party does not have close relations in need of these herbs, or that they would not sell them for a considerable fortune.
This was why Chu Xin’er initially avoided the marketplace, choosing instead to search in the wild.
Luoyao Market was a medium-sized market within the Ling Tian Sect’s sphere of influence.
Because several nearby family clans depended on the Ling Tian Sect, conflicts and strife were rare. The market was managed very prosperously. Though not comparable to the Ling Tian City market, it was the largest within tens of thousands of miles.
Walking through the streets of Luoyao Market, Chu Xin’er gazed at the densely packed shops and pavilions, and the steady flow of male and female cultivators. Her heart was filled with awe.
The Northern Territory of Pingzhou was truly a sacred place for cultivation. Just in this single market, there were probably over ten thousand cultivators—many times more than at the Qingye Sect where she came from.
Among so many cultivators, though most were at the Qi Refining stage, there were certainly some senior figures at the Foundation Establishment and Core Formation stages. To avoid being targeted or envied, Chu Xin’er had to be even more cautious and low-key.
She decided not to visit the large pill shops, since spiritual herbs for refining Foundation Establishment pills held little appeal to cultivators above that stage.
It would be best to find such herbs in shops avoided by high-level cultivators, at least to avoid attracting powerful adversaries she could not resist.
The shop before her had no attendants, only a middle-aged man who appeared to be the shopkeeper dozing behind the counter. The shelves storing spiritual herbs and pills were sparse.
Hearing footsteps, the middle-aged man looked up and smiled, greeting her: "Welcome. May I ask if you are here to sell herbs or purchase pills?"
Chu Xin’er was seeking Purple Violet Vine, Jasmine Cloud Grass, and Antelope Blood Ginseng, so choosing a shop specializing in spiritual pills was natural. His question was not surprising.
Seeing that the man’s cultivation was only at the thirteenth tier of the Heavenly Realm, roughly equal to her own, Chu Xin’er nodded and smiled: “Fellow cultivator, do you have Purple Violet Vine over three hundred years old, or Jasmine Cloud Grass and Antelope Blood Ginseng?”
“Hmm? This young lady wants to buy three-hundred-year-old Purple Violet Vine, Jasmine Cloud Grass, and Antelope Blood Ginseng? These are the main ingredients for refining Foundation Establishment pills. Could she be planning to have someone refine such a pill for her?”
The middle-aged man’s cultivation was not high. The reason he could open such a pill-selling shop was due to his background; he had served as an apprentice pharmacist in a Spiritual Herb sect for many years. Having been immersed in the environment, he could refine some Qi Refining pills himself.
Though now out of the sect, he could still stand firm in the marketplace by selling low-level pills like Qi Gathering Pills and Spirit Condensing Pills, living quite comfortably.
He was also collecting materials for refining Foundation Establishment pills. Hearing Chu Xin’er inquire about Purple Violet Vine, his heart stirred, though his face remained cheerful as he said:
“Three-hundred-year-old Purple Violet Vine and Antelope Blood Ginseng? I do have one specimen of each, but the price is rather steep...”
Unexpectedly lucky, Chu Xin’er felt a surge of excitement but still pretended to be anxious, frowning as she said:
“Steep? How steep? Please state your price. As long as the quality is good and within my budget, I’ll take both the Purple Violet Vine and the Antelope Blood Ginseng.”
Though Chu Xin’er appeared tense and reluctant, the middle-aged man who often dealt with cultivators could tell she was not being sincere. Smiling, he continued:
“Purple Violet Vine is seven hundred and sixty spirit stones, Antelope Blood Ginseng is a bit more expensive. If you plan to buy them together, I can give you a discount—one thousand six hundred spirit stones in total.”
Hearing that it only cost one thousand six hundred spirit stones, Chu Xin’er breathed a long sigh of relief.
Indeed, the spirit stones obtained from several battles totaled over ten thousand. She had spent less than half on pills and still had six to seven thousand remaining.
Two herbs for sixteen hundred, plus the remaining Jasmine Cloud Grass would not exceed three thousand in total. Her spirit stones were more than enough to buy two sets.
Moreover, her storage bags contained unused artifacts such as black banners and flying swords, and over a dozen spiritual herbs to sell. Chu Xin’er had no worries about a lack of spirit stones.
However, knowing the wisdom of not flaunting wealth, she could not show too much extravagance. She continued to frown:
“One thousand six hundred? That’s quite a lot. Could you please let me inspect the quality of the herbs before I decide?”
